What happens when you take the best player in the nation and the most improved player in Louisiana and put them together?
You get the Louisiana Sports Writers Association’s Class 5A All-State basketball teams led by Mikaylah Williams of Parkway and Dorian Booker Dorian Booker 6'10" | PF Scotlandville | 2023 State LA of Scotlandville.
Williams, an LSU signee and the nation’s top recruit in 2023, is the Outstanding Player on the LSWA’s 5A girls squad for the second straight year. The 6-foot-10 Booker, an UNO signee and a returning all-state pick, is the Outstanding Player on the 5A boys squad.
Williams’ coach, Gloria Williams, is the 5A girls Coach of the Year, while Derrick Jones of Division I select champion Catholic of Baton Rouge claims the 5A boys Coach of the Year honor.
Mikaylah Williams (6-1) averaged 19 points, 7.1 rebounds and 4.4 assists per game while leading her team to a Division I nonselect title. In the title game, she scored 34 points and pulled down 11 rebounds. Parkway finished with a 26-1 record for Gloria Williams.
Booker displayed refined skills in the lane and added confidence while averaging 22.1 points, 7.8 rebounds and 4.3 blocked shots per game for Division II select runner-up Scotlandville. He made 74 percent of his field goal attempts.
Jones coached his alma mater to the first basketball title in school history. Catholic (28-6) lost to District 4-5A rival Scotlandville twice before beating the Hornets in the title game.
